How do patents and copyrights encourage innovation?
matrenka [14]

Patents and copyrights encourage innovation because they allow people to be rewarded for their creations. For example, if an individual creates a new type of cell phone they can receive a patent or copyright on that phone. This means the ability to make and sell this phone belongs solely to the individual or the company they represent.

Now if this cell phone becomes wildly popular and people start to buy it, it allows the creator to make a significant amount of money of their creation. Along with this, the person can sue any person who tries to take their design and sell the phone themselves.

Ultimately, patents and copyrights protect people who come up with amazing innovations and allows them to accumulate massive amounts of wealth.
